Calories in UDI'S, RICH & HEARTY WHOLE GRAIN HAMBURGER BUNS

Serving Size: 1 BUN (77.0g)
Amount Per Serving
  • Calories 190.2
  • Total Fat 6.0 g
  • Saturated Fat 0.0 g
  • Cholesterol 0.0 mg
  • Sodium 350.4 mg
  • Potassium 0.0 mg
  • Total Carbohydrate 35.0 g
  • Dietary Fiber 6.0 g
  • Sugars 4.0 g
  • Protein 5.0 g

Ingredients

WATER, TAPIOCA STARCH, BROWN RICE FLOUR, RESISTANT CORN STARCH, CANOLA OIL, EGG WHITES, CANE SUGAR SYRUP, TAPIOCA MALTODEXTRIN, TEFF FLOUR, CITRUS FIBER, DRIED CANE SYRUP, YEAST, FLAX SEED, POTATO FLOUR, SUGAR CANE FIBER, SALT, DRY MOLASSES, GUM (XANTHAN GUM, SODIUM ALGINATE, GUAR GUM), CULTURED CORN SYRUP SOLIDS AND CITRIC ACID (MOLD INHIBITOR), XANTHAN GUM AND ENZYMES.

Calorie Analysis

The food UDI'S, RICH & HEARTY WHOLE GRAIN HAMBURGER BUNS, based on the serving size listed above, would account for 9.5% of your daily allotted calories based on a 2,000 calorie diet. The majority of the calories for this food comes from carbohydrates. Carbohydrates make up 73.6% of the calories.
